St. Petersburg’s Serrel Smith shines in college audition
Serrel Smith's workout Thursday afternoon was typical of any other. The St. Petersburg standout took shots all along the perimeter, showing off his long-range capabilities.

It was those in attendance that set this session apart.

Sitting on folding chairs along the sideline were head coaches or assistants from Georgia, Miami, Tennessee and West Virginia. They all flew in for this workout, which was scheduled five hours after the recruiting dead period officially ended.

BasketballRecruiting.Rivals.com - ARS Rescue Rooter Tampa Hoopfest: Evans' Saturday Takeaways
A slender, baby-faced, scoring savant that is one of the most improved prospects since the summer months, Serrel Smith went absolutely bonkers on Saturday against one of the best backcourts in America. Oak Hill Academy, bolstered by the talents of Kentucky, Florida and Oregon recruits, each being found within the top-70 of the Rivals150, did their best to guard Smith but his scoring acumen off of jump stops, jab steps, catch and shoots and slice and scores was as impressive of a performance that had been seen all year long.

Headed to Ole Miss in the fall, Andy Kennedy has come to value high level scoring guards that tend to fly under the radar. The St. Petersburg product fits the mold perfectly. Primarily heralded as a fringe high-major prospect entering his senior year, Smith has shown great progressions since his travel ball career finished up. On Saturday, one high-major college coach remarked that he reminded him of a young Jamal Crawford; high markings but one that was pretty accurate seeing that he scored 42 points against some of the best guards in America.
